Africa stands at the forefront of a renewable energy revolution, poised to leverage its abundant natural resources and drive sustainable development. With unparalleled solar, wind, and hydropower potential, coupled with critical minerals essential for clean technologies, the continent holds immense promise for advancing the green transition. African nations have set ambitious targets to expand renewable energy capacity from 56 GW in 2022 to 300 GW by 2030, aiming to electrify communities, stimulate economic growth, and establish global leadership in climate action.

Aquila Capital

Founded 2001DEU
SolarWindEnergy StorageInfrastructure & Other
Type: Developer, Investor, Lender
Aquila Capital is an investment and asset management company specialising in clean energy, green infrastructure, and sustainable real estate, operating as an investor and developer across Europe and New Zealand. They provide tailored fund vehicles and investment solutions with a focus on sustainability. Aquila Capital's real asset portfolio includes solar PV, wind energy, hydropower, battery energy storage systems (BESS), data centers, forestry, green logistics and energy efficiency projects. The company's portfolio comprises 77 projects with a total capacity of 795 MW, including 295 MW operational, 400 MW under construction/RTB, and 100 MW pre-RTB. Projects are located in Spain, Portugal, and New Zealand.

Aquila Capital develops, owns, and operates renewable energy projects. Key differentiators include their focus on sustainability and their ability to offer tailored investment solutions.

Vena Energy

Founded 2012SGP
SolarWindOther RenewablesEnergy StorageInfrastructure & Other
Type: Developer, Investor
Headquartered in Singapore, Vena Energy is a leading renewable energy company in the Asia-Pacific region that owns, develops, constructs, operates, manages, and commercialises a renewable energy portfolio totaling 40 GW of solar, onshore wind, offshore wind, battery storage, and hybrid renewable energy projects.

Vena Energy has a fully integrated business model and an extensive local presence throughout the region with 67 corporate and site offices in Australia, India, Indonesia, Japan, Philippines, Singapore, South Korea, Taiwan, and Thailand. Vena Energy is committed to engaging with local communities throughout the lifecycle of its portfolio projects, as well as incorporating internationally recognized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) standards into its strategy and business practices.

Enel Group

Founded 1962ITA
SolarWindOther RenewablesEnergy StorageInfrastructure & Other
Type: Developer, Investor
Enel Group is a multinational utility and IPP specializing in renewable energy technologies across Europe, the Americas, Asia, and Africa. A significant player in the energy transition, Enel is committed to sustainable power generation. They operate across solar, wind, hydro and geothermal technologies, with a portfolio of over 56 GW of operational renewable capacity and over 1300 projects globally. The company develops, owns, and operates renewable energy projects long-term. Enel differentiates itself through its scale and experience as one of the world's largest private producers of clean energy. Currently, Enel seeks to expand its renewable energy portfolio through development and acquisition in key global markets, especially in solar and wind projects.

Australian Renewable Energy Agency

Founded 2012AUS
SolarWindOther RenewablesEnergy StorageInfrastructure & Other
Type: Investor, Lender
The Australian Renewable Energy Agency (ARENA), established by the Australian Government in 2012, is a government agency focused on accelerating Australia's shift to affordable and reliable renewable energy and supporting the global transition to net zero emissions. As an investor and lender, ARENA supports pre-commercial innovation to benefit Australian consumers, businesses, and workers. ARENA's activities are anchored by emissions reduction goals of 43% by 2030 and net zero by 2050. ARENA's portfolio comprises 763 projects across solar, wind, energy storage and other renewable energy technologies. While specific capacity breakdowns are not available, ARENA provides financial assistance for research and development of early-stage technologies, demonstration of new technologies and business models, and pre-commercial deployment of technologies. ARENA operates as an investor, providing financial assistance to projects, and fosters collaboration across government agencies. The agency seeks to increase the supply of renewable energy in Australia and achieve the Australian Government's climate change and energy objectives.

ib vogt GmbH

Founded 2002DEU
SolarEnergy StorageInfrastructure & Other
Type: Investor
ib vogt GmbH, established in 2002, is a privately held Independent Power Producer (IPP) and developer specializing in utility-scale solar PV plants and battery storage projects globally. The company operates across the entire value chain, providing development, financing, EPC (Engineering, Procurement, and Construction), O&M (Operations & Maintenance), and asset management services. Headquartered in Berlin, Germany, ib vogt has a presence in over 35 countries across Europe, Asia Pacific, the Americas, and Africa. They focus on decarbonizing the global electricity sector through the development and long-term ownership of renewable energy assets. The company has constructed or has under construction more than 4.7 GW of PV power plants globally and boasts a development pipeline exceeding 55 GWp. ib vogt has a strong OECD-focused development strategy, investments in BESS technology and is expanding its IPP business model. Recent projects include the 513.1 MWp Segovia Cluster in Spain. ib vogt's portfolio includes projects in various stages across multiple countries including Germany, the UK, and the USA. ib vogt leverages its in-house team of over 900 staff and numerous global partnerships. They are actively seeking opportunities to expand their IPP portfolio and BESS applications globally, particularly in the OECD markets.
